1 1 2 0 3 0 4 1 5 0 6 2 7 0 8 3 9 2 10 4 11 0 12 15 13 0 14 6 15 4 16 7 17 0 18 40 19 0 20 9 21 6 22 10 23 0 24 77 25 4 26 12 27 8 28 39 29 0 30 630 31 0 32 15 33 10 34 16 35 12 36 187 37 0 38 18 39 12 40 133 41 0 42 260 43 0 44 21 45 56 46 22 47 0 48 345 49 6 50 72 51 16 52 75 53 0 54 442 55 20 56 189 57 18 58 28 59 0 60 6061 61 0 62 30 63 40 64 31 65 12 66 3360 67 0 68 33 69 22 70 3978 71 0 72 805 73 0 74 36 75 168 76 111 77 30 78 950 79 0 80 195 81 26 82 40 83 0 84 12177 85 16 86 42 87 28 88 301 89 0 90 21692 91 12 92 45 93 30 94 46 95 36 96 1457 97 0 98 624 99 32 100 931 101 0 102 1650 103 0 104 357 105 2380 106 52 107 0 108 1855 109 0 110 378 111 36 112 165 113 0 114 10360 115 44 116 57 117 152 118 58 119 48 120 52923 121 10 122 60 123 40 124 183 125 24 126 43214 127 0 128 63 129 42 130 14400 131 0 132 30745 133 18 134 66 135 572 136 469 137 0 138 3060 139 0 140 11799 141 46 142 70 143 60 144 3337 145 28 146 72 147 240 148 219 149 0 150 105154 151 0 152 525 153 200 154 20748 155 60 156 3927 157 0 158 78 159 52 160 2449 161 66 162 4240 163 0 164 81 165 6048 166 82 167 0 168 104995 169 12 170 2772 171 56 172 255 173 0 174 24510 175 408 176 435 177 58 178 88 179 0 180 183785 181 0 182 5850 183 60 184 91 185 36 186 28060 187 80 188 93 189 806 190 31302 191 0 192 5985 193 0 194 96 195 8512 196 2619 197 0 198 108290 199 0 200 1287 201 66 202 100 203 84 204 74437 205 40 206 102 207 136 208 1545 209 90 210 8532264 211 0 212 105 213 70 214 106 215 84 216 7597 217 30 218 108 219 72 220 89053 221 48 222 8030 223 0 224 3441 225 1628 226 112 227 0 228 93225 229 0 230 1710 231 3040 232 805 233 0 234 151844 235 92 236 117 237 78 238 50622 239 0 240 441847 241 0 242 840 243 80 244 363 245 816 246 49410 247 36 248 861 249 82 250 6076 251 0 252 72625 253 110 254 126 255 2100 256 127 257 0 258 10880 259 36 260 41667 261 344 262 130 263 0 264 262131 265 52 266 63492 267 88 268 399 269 0 270 632078 271 0 272 135 273 3420 274 136 275 216 276 137137 277 0 278 138 279 184 280 298155 281 0 282 13020 283 0 284 141 285 2632 286 74550 287 120 288 13585 289 16 290 2736 291 96 292 435 293 0 294 580642 295 116 296 147 297 1274 298 148 299 132 300 870309 301 42 302 150 303 100 304 2265 305 60 306 260984 307 0 308 19737 309 102 310 84546 311 0 312 367195 313 0 314 156 315 35464 316 471 317 0 318 16590 319 140 320 3339 321 106 322 18720 323 144 324 17227 325 192 326 162 327 108 328 1141 329 138 330 33696260 331 0 332 165 333 440 334 166 335 132 336 871239 337 0 338 4200 339 112 340 215137 341 30 342 19210 343 48 344 1197 345 27132 346 172 347 0 348 218845 349 0 350 196098 351 1508 352 5425 353 0 354 102960 355 140 356 177 357 5900 358 178 359 0 360 1512371 361 18 362 180 363 480 364 83079 365 72 366 110110 367 0 368 915 369 488 370 120888 371 156 372 250305 373 0 374 14322 375 4588 376 1309 377 84 378 1245500 379 0 380 89775 381 126 382 190 383 0 384 24257 385 34884 386 192 387 128 388 579 389 0 390 55883058 391 176 392 2145 393 130 394 196 395 156 396 903245 397 0 398 198 399 9240 400 15721 401 0 402 26600 403 60 404 201 405 5360 406 149682 407 180 408 630315 409 0 410 5508 411 136 412 615 413 174 414 479774 415 164 416 6417 417 138 418 161616 419 0 420 142262747 421 0 422 210 423 280 424 1477 425 168 426 149460 427 60 428 213 429 43168 430 163710 431 0 432 30745 433 0 434 171288 435 43344 436 651 437 198 438 31610 439 0 440 82563 441 4526 442 3300 443 0 444 357357 445 88 446 222 447 148 448 14049 449 0 450 2970464 451 40 452 225 453 150 454 226 455 48960 456 788371 457 0 458 228 459 1976 460 395941 461 0 462 18756270 463 0 464 1155 465 7084 466 232 467 0 468 252805 469 66 470 7254 471 156 472 1645 473 210 474 185260 475 1128 476 142911 477 632 478 238 479 0 480 3610095 481 36 482 240 483 2720 484 10363 485 96 486 38962 487 0 488 1701 489 162 490 1633092 491 0 492 439285 493 112 494 227550 495 88396 496 3705 497 210 498 40920 499 0 500 8217 501 166 502 250 503 0 504 2976107 505 100 506 1260 507 3192 508 759 509 0 510 125730254 511 72 512 255 513 2210 514 256 515 204 516 483417 517 230 518 244842 519 172 520 1040403 521 0 522 764660 523 0 524 261 525 334776 526 262 527 240 528 2163175 529 22 530 27720 531 176 532 35775 533 120 534 235410 535 212 536 1869 537 178 538 268 539 912 540 5152157 541 0 542 270 543 180 544 8401 545 108 546 155425424 547 0 548 273 549 728 550 1463434 551 252 552 1157475 553 78 554 276 555 70840 556 831 557 0 558 874310 559 84 560 815517 561 74400 562 280 563 0 564 52547 565 112 566 282 567 3760 568 1981 569 0 570 175896252 571 0 572 208335 573 190 574 23166 575 456 576 54817 577 0 578 3168 579 192 580 631465 581 246 582 55970 583 260 584 2037 585 123772 586 292 587 0 588 4742205 589 90 590 11466 591 196 592 885 593 0 594 3090536 595 84252 596 297 597 198 598 67050 599 0 600 7080619 601 0 602 66300 603 200 604 903 605 1080 606 303510 607 0 608 9393 609 86860 610 331056 611 276 612 61915 613 0 614 306 615 87108 616 1468995 617 0 618 63140 619 0 620 240711 621 2678 622 310 623 264 624 3025719 625 124 626 312 627 2912 628 939 629 144 630 730089250 631 0 632 315 633 210 634 316 635 252 636 735757 637 720 638 42294 639 424 640 40513 641 0 642 68160 643 0 644 262899 645 95872 646 393162 647 0 648 69445 649 290 650 682668 651 24840 652 975 653 0 654 353710 655 260 656 1635 657 872 658 396552 659 0 660 556882179 661 0 662 330 663 20900 664 2317 665 105468 666 73372 667 308 668 333 669 222 670 399798 671 60 672 1419395 673 0 674 336 675 15008 676 17187 677 0 678 76050 679 96 680 198315 681 226 682 435540 683 0 684 2709245 685 136 686 33174 687 228 688 5145 689 156 690 312977048 691 0 692 345 693 349370 694 346 695 276 696 1843611 697 80 698 348 699 232 700 4802589 701 0 702 4322150 703 36 704 2457 705 16380 706 352 707 300 708 912505 709 0 710 49914 711 472 712 2485 713 330 714 349384452 715 122688 716 357 717 238 718 358 719 0 720 12269543 721 102 722 13320 723 240 724 1083 725 144 726 5670730 727 0 728 186945 729 242 730 475020 731 336 732 975645 733 0 734 366 735 463112 736 11377 737 330 738 1532720 739 0 740 343539 741 130872 742 101010 743 0 744 2107651 745 148 746 372 747 248 748 1074613 749 318 750 13875774 751 0 752 375 753 250 754 535800 755 300 756 10125089 757 0 758 378 759 34272 760 2231931 761 0 762 96140 763 108 764 381 765 212344 766 382 767 348 768 97665 769 0 770 49097088 771 256 772 1155 773 0 774 1686434 775 1848 776 2709 777 28380 778 388 779 360 780 921367895 781 70 782 12870 783 260 784 43401 785 156 786 511560 787 0 788 393 789 262 790 556722 791 336 792 7375835 793 60 794 396 795 145992 796 1191 797 0 798 488642510 799 368 800 21147 801 1064 802 400 803 360 804 1177737 805 155040 806 613050 807 268 808 2821 809 0 810 17496836 811 0 812 9315 813 270 814 88914 815 324 816 5183959 817 126 818 408 819 244528 820 1266673 821 0 822 111930 823 0 824 2877 825 831316 826 48204 827 0 828 113575 829 0 830 22770 831 276 832 26145 833 2832 834 576160 835 332 836 448275 837 3614 838 418 839 0 840 2323173573 841 28 842 420 843 280 844 1263 845 1344 846 2015894 847 2280 848 2115 849 282 850 3511144 851 396 852 1323025 853 0 854 670098 855 265540 856 427 857 0 858 122101980 859 0 860 24453 861 174460 862 430 863 0 864 123697 865 172 866 432 867 7200 868 479331 869 390 870 629262242 871 132 872 3045 873 1160 874 725940 875 10788 876 1398837 877 0 878 438 879 292 880 6069175 881 0 882 3223000 883 0 884 502299 885 25872 886 442 887 0 888 3005755 889 126 890 78588 891 2960 892 1335 893 414 894 662310 895 356 896 56769 897 192508 898 448 899 420 900 24030929 901 208 902 28350 903 9600 904 3157 905 180 906 680260 907 0 908 453 909 1208 910 243810258 911 0 912 6479655 913 410 914 456 915 27664 916 1371 917 390 918 7403570 919 0 920 363987 921 306 922 460 923 420 924 1538823071 925 552 926 462 927 616 928 14353 929 0 930 26524560 931 528 932 465 933 310 934 466 935 23436 936 10311827 937 0 938 62244 939 312 940 1666357 941 0 942 147110 943 440 944 2355 945 1977572 946 842520 947 0 948 148995 949 72 950 209034 951 316 952 141075 953 0 954 150892 955 380 956 477 957 218784 958 478 959 408 960 29184991 961 30 962 175200 963 320 964 1443 965 192 966 869073474 967 0 968 14007 969 32200 970 840708 971 0 972 156655 973 138 974 486 975 1162836 976 7305 977 0 978 158600 979 440 980 4418115 981 1304 982 490 983 0 984 3692811 985 196 986 102828 987 11480 988 36975 989 462 990 2849568358 991 0 992 15345 993 330 994 909168 995 396 996 1809577 997 0 998 498 999 4316 1000 99301